    I have a BCD996T made by uniden its a digital scanner works for most digital systems. Its gps based as well (what this means is you hook up one of those old gps's like a garmin V to it and it only scans the channels based on the radius you select I use a 30 mile radius all this does is only activate the channels within a 30 mile radius of your location great for truckin) I have several states programmed into it like Mi, ohio, Ind, Ky etc. Also alot of Canadian agencies as well. Love it never have to switch from state to state the gps does it all. Anything under 150.00 will not do what you want it to you won't get any digital stuff most law enforcement agencies are digital now. Be prepared to spend 400 US for it but well worth it you get alot of info you won't get on CB for sure.     You will also want to check the laws for your area--particularly if you will be trucking in the US. Some states prohibit the installation of mobile scanners and will seize your expensive investment as well as FINE you for having it! I have to wonder what such states have to HIDE since many states, OTH, don't have such jackbooted laws!!!!! New York, Indiana, "Noo Joisey" are states to watch. The "scanner laws" can be found on the internet.

    Soon, everything will be Digital so whatever scanner you buy now, wont work like you would like it to.
    The Digial ones run around $500, handheld or mobile.

    I have one of the Radio Shaft PRO 164's right now, works great. I will be purchasing a Digital one soon as everyone around me is going Digital by Jan 2010.
